摘要
Inorganic semiconductor chemiresistors have been the mainstream of well-explored gas sensing technology. However, the intrinsic fragile and rigid nature seriously impedes their future application in the thriving wearable sensing devices. Herein, we demonstrate a flexible all-inorganic semiconductor-based chemiresistive sensor through in-situ anchoring nanosheets-assembled SnO2/SnS2 sensing layer on flexible yttria-stabilized zirconia (YSZ) ceramic nanofiber networks. It is revealed that the flexible YSZ ceramic substrate possesses low section modulus in bending and good toughness that is mainly derived from its unique nanofiber structure (300 nm in diameter) and ultrafine grain size (16 nm). It is first demonstrated that nanosheets-assembled sensing layer characterized by abundant void spaces plays a pivotal role in affecting the flexibility of inorganic nanofiber networks. The void spaces between SnO2/SnS2 nanosheets, acting as stress-accommodating microstructures, could effectively releasing stress concentration, enabling abnormal mechanical flexibility of inorganic YSZ/SnO2/SnS2 network. In addition, to achieve more compatibility with wearable application and realize room-temperature gas sensing function, visible light rather than traditional high heat is employed as excitation source to activate the flexible YSZ/SnO2/SnS2 chemiresistor. This work shows the possibility of inorganic semiconductor chemiresistor for application in wearable sensing device and offers a valuable guidance for constructing flexible room-temperature inorganic chemiresistor.
